An Act to provide fair wages to employees of public institutions of higher education.
Be it enacted by the Senate and House of Representatives in General Court assembled, and by the authority 
of the same, as follows:
1 SECTION 1. Section 6 of said chapter 29 is hereby amended by adding the following 
2paragraph:-
3 The operating budget in the current and ensuing fiscal years shall include the 
4appropriation necessary to fund all incremental cost items for all years covered by any collective 
5bargaining agreement to which either the board of trustees of the university of Massachusetts or 
6the board of higher education is a party, separate and apart from any appropriation for the 
7general maintenance of the university or public institutions of higher education where the board 
8of higher education is the employer for purposes of collective bargaining under chapter 150E, 
9excluding grant funded and auxiliary enterprises accounts funded positions. 
10 SECTION 2. Notwithstanding section 8 of chapter 32A of the General Laws or any other 
11general or special law to the contrary, the cost of fringe benefits, including, but not limited to, the 
12cost of pensions and health insurance, associated with employees of a public institution of higher  2 of 2
13education as defined in section 5 of chapter 15A, shall be the obligation of the commonwealth, 
14excluding grant funded and auxiliary enterprises accounts funded positions. 
15 SECTION 3. Subsection (c) of section 7 of Chapter 150E, as appearing in the 2022 
16Official Edition, is amended in the second paragraph by striking the third sentence and inserting 
17the following the following sentence: -
18 The board of higher education and the board of trustees of the University of 
19Massachusetts shall include in any such submission a certification that the incremental cost items 
20in such collective bargaining agreement are adequate to ensure that average salaries for faculty 
21and staff in Massachusetts will, by the end of the contract terms, for each broad job category, be 
22at least at the national average, adjusted for cost of living.
